We are yet to find out whether this latest move by the Uganda Police Force calls for celebrations or worry! Well, on the 19th day of October, 2020, Police Spokesperson, Mr. Fred Enanga announced that they would recruit 50,000 Election Constables and an additional 5,000 SPC’s to join the force.
One might wonder why the Uganda Police Force decided to increase its numbers at this particular time and in response to this, Mr. Fred Enanga stated that the major reason why more officers were being recruited was to support the force during the forthcoming general elections. The Police Spokesperson added that the Election Constables would however be disbanded immediately after the elections.
When asked about the welfare of the Constables, Mr. Fred Enanga disclosed that each Election constable would be paid a total sum of 375,200 as their allowance for their services during the election period. He further specified that the suitable candidates would be those that possess a national Identity card, have no criminal record, aged between 18 to 40, and have a proven record of volunteering with police.
However, all this left the public worried with some wondering whether the Election Constables would be given thorough training so as to ensure that they observe people’s human rights while conducting their duties in the election period.
History has taught us a mal-trained force is nothing but a danger to society as seen from the several cases of brutality by the Local defense forces while enforcing the COVID-19 regulations earlier this year. In addition to this, several Human Rights Advocates fear that recruitment of officers at such a time will intimidate the public. In fact, the Uganda Police is said to require 14.1 Billion for training its officers.
